Croc slide spotted at lake girraween.
Looks to be off one about 2m max not sure if its a saltie. Probably not. Otherwise somebodys dog would have been taken by now.
Have seen eyeshine in there years ago too.
But no doubt it's slowy getting bigger...... Just be a bit careful with kids or dogs at the ramp area fellas.
Better safe than sorry. ....

More pics from there spotted the crocs bow wave leaving the shallows as we pulled up this morning.
Could see a fair bit of action on the surface from togas but dropped the lot of them on a nilsmaster spearhead in silver n black. I reckon you're lucky to get 10% to stay connected.
No hits from the barra.
Got nothing except a few pics... and a bit of casting practice.
Gonna head out to lake Bennet one day shortly. P!ss easy to catch a few sooties on lures n bait. Barra are a different story though. But over the years I've found that your lures have got to be in the water not the cupboard to get them .....
